Ingredients
To achieve that perfectly cooked salmon, you’ll need a handful of simple ingredients. Here’s what you’ll require for this easy salmon recipe:
- 4 salmon fillets (about 6 ounces each)
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 teaspoons gar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Fresh lemon slices (for garnish)
- Fresh herbs (such as dill or parsley, optional)
Optional Marinade
If you’re interested in upping the flavor profile, consider marinating the salmon for about 15-30 minutes. Combine olive oil, soy sauce, honey, and Dijon mustard for a quick and delicious marinade that takes this dish to the next level!
Instructions
Follow these simple steps to master how to cook salmon perfectly every single time:
-
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). This temperature is ideal for cooking salmon evenly while locking in moisture.
-
Prepare the Baking Sheet: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or foil for easy cleanup. This will also help the salmon cook evenly.
-
Season the Salmon: Place your salmon fillets on the prepared baking sheet, skin-side down.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per.
-
Bake the Salmon: Bake in the preheated oven for about 12-15 minutes, depending on the thickness of the fillets. The salmon should flake easily with a fork and have an internal temperature of 145°F (63°C).
-
Serve: Once the salmon is cooked, remove it from the oven. Garnish with fresh lemon slices and herbs if desired. Serve immediately for the best flavor and texture!
Tips and Variations
-
Cooking Methods: This easy recipe is perfect for baking, but you can also grill, pan-sear, or broil your salmon for different flavor profiles. If you choose to grill, use a grill basket to keep the fillets intact.
-
Bake with Vegetables: For a complete meal, toss some seasonal vegetables like asparagus, bell peppers, or zucchini onto the baking sheet. They’ll absorb the salmon’s flavors and cook beautifully alongside.
-
Flavor Boosts: Want to switch up the flavors? Try adding a honey mustard glaze or a mixture of soy sauce, ginger, and sesame oil for an Asian twist.
-
Leftovers: Salmon makes for great leftovers. Flake any unused portions into a salad, sandwich, or even pasta for a quick meal option the next day.
